BatRep = Battle report. It's a video of a 40k battle. I honestly believe there are only 2 types of batreps:
- one where we only see what happens after a player's turn and the guy filming explains what happened
- miniwargaming's style, where you see everything (the rolls, movement, assault, etc. etc.) and you have someone explaining everything.
